J A Penner is a scholar working on Hematology, Cardiology and Cardiovascular Medicine and Genetics. According to data from OpenAlex, J A Penner has authored 16 papers receiving a total of 666 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Hematology, 4 papers in Cardiology and Cardiovascular Medicine and 3 papers in Genetics. Recurrent topics in J A Penner's work include Antiplatelet Therapy and Cardiovascular Diseases (4 papers), Blood Coagulation and Thrombosis Mechanisms (4 papers) and Venous Thromboembolism Diagnosis and Management (3 papers). J A Penner is often cited by papers focused on Antiplatelet Therapy and Cardiovascular Diseases (4 papers), Blood Coagulation and Thrombosis Mechanisms (4 papers) and Venous Thromboembolism Diagnosis and Management (3 papers). J A Penner collaborates with scholars based in United States. J A Penner's co-authors include David L. Aronson, Richard W. Counts, MW Hilgartner, Joseph C. Fratantoni, Louis M. Aledort, J. Roger Edson, Jack Lazerson, Carol K. Kasper, Campbell W. McMillan and Peter H. Levine and has published in prestigious journals such as Nature, Blood and Plastic & Reconstructive Surgery.
